Understanding the Aviator Game Mechanics

At its core, aviator relies on a provably fair random number generator (RNG). This means the outcome of each round is not predetermined, and it’s possible to verify its randomness. When a round begins, a plane takes off, and a multiplier starts increasing, typically from 1x upwards. The multiplier’s growth is exponential, creating the potential for substantial winnings. The round ends when the plane flies away, and your bet is lost if you haven’t cashed out before that point. The multiplier at the moment you cash out determines your winnings – for instance, a bet of $10 at a 2.5x multiplier yields $25.

Developing Effective Aviator Strategies

There are several approaches players adopt when engaging with aviator. One common strategy is the ‘low-risk, consistent profit’ method, where players aim to cash out at multipliers between 1.1x and 1.5x. This approach ensures frequent small wins, minimizing the chances of losing a substantial amount on a single round. Another strategy is the ‘martingale’ system, where players double their bet after each loss, hoping to recover their losses with a single win. However, this can be risky, as it requires a substantial bankroll and doesn’t guarantee success. Utilizing Auto Cash-Out Features

Many aviator platforms offer an auto cash-out feature, which allows you to pre-set a multiplier at which your bet will automatically be cashed out. This is a valuable tool for implementing consistent strategies and removing the emotional element from the game. For example, if you’re aiming for a 1.5x multiplier, you can set the auto cash-out to that value, ensuring you secure that profit every time – provided the round doesn’t end before reaching that point. This feature is particularly useful for players employing the ‘low-risk’ strategy, as it automates the process and prevents impulsive decisions. However, bear in mind that auto cash-out is not a perfect solution; the round could end before the target multiplier is reached.
